Escape Sequence Quick Reference
The following table is a quick reference between the escape sequences listed
in ascending order, according to numeric values. For detailed definitions,
see Chapter 5 “Control Code Definitions”.
Escape Sequence Quick Reference
Decimal Description
ESC SO Select Double-Wide (expanded) Mode (one line only)
ESC SI Select Condensed Mode (compressed)
ESC US (0) Select Top-Down Printing
ESC US (1) Select Bottom-Up Printing
ESC SP n Define Inter-Character Space
ESC “!“ n Master Select
ESC “$” n1 n2 Set Print Position (absolute)
ESC “%” (0) Select Default Character Set
ESC “%” (1) Select User-Defined Character Set
ESC “&” NUL k1 k2 s1 d1...d11 Define User-Defined Characters
ESC “*” m n1 n2 Select Graphics Mode
ESC “+” n d1...dn Print Character Graphics
ESC “-” 0* Cancel Underline Mode
ESC “-” 1* Select Underline Mode
ESC “/” c Select Vertical Tab Channel
ESC “0” Select 1/8 inch Line Spacing
ESC “1” Select 7/72 inch Line Spacing
ESC “2” Select 1/6 inch Line Spacing
ESC “3” n Select n/216 inch Line Spacing
ESC “4” Select Italic Mode
ESC “5” Cancel Italic Mode
ESC “6” Enable Printing of Codes 128-255
ESC “7” Disable Printing of Codes 128-255
ESC “<” Select Unidirectional Printing (one line only)
